Unpacking the Dubbing Process: Delays and Determinations

The process of dubbing anime isn’t instantaneous. Several factors contribute to the delay between the original Japanese release and the availability of dubbed versions. These factors include securing voice actors, translating the script, adapting it for lip-sync, recording the dialogue, and performing post-production editing. Moreover, licensing agreements and studio schedules play a significant role in determining the release timeline.

Factors Influencing Release Schedules

While the 2-3 week window is a good estimate, several factors can potentially delay the release of the English dubbed version:

  • Production Delays: Unforeseen issues during the dubbing process, such as voice actor availability conflicts or technical difficulties, can push back the release date.
  • Licensing Issues: Negotiation and finalization of licensing agreements between distributors and streaming services can sometimes take longer than anticipated.
  • Holiday Schedules: Major holidays can disrupt production schedules and potentially delay the release of dubbed episodes.
  • SimulDub Strategies: Some services experiment with “simuldubbing,” releasing dubbed episodes almost simultaneously with the Japanese broadcast. While exciting, this is less common and hasn’t been the standard practice for Solo Leveling thus far.

  1. What is “simuldubbing” and is Solo Leveling likely to employ it? Simuldubbing involves releasing the English dubbed version of an anime episode very shortly after the original Japanese broadcast. While some anime series utilize this approach, Solo Leveling has traditionally opted for a delayed dub release, making simuldubbing unlikely.
